- complaint#862359494
6 violations found (6 high severity).
Prohibited Punishments - Corporal Punishment
HighDuring a DFPS investigation, it was found that a child was hit on the head by a caregiver.
746.2805(1)Corrected 2024-01-19Basic Requirements for Infants - Never Unsupervised
HighDuring a DFPS investigation, it was found that infants had been left unsupervised while caregiver was outside with a group of school-age children.
746.2401(7)Corrected 2024-01-19Prohibited Punishments - Humiliating, Rejecting, Yelling
HighDuring a DFPS investigation is was found that the children in the 3 year old classroom were being yelled at.
746.2805(5)Corrected 2024-01-19Director's Absence - Employees Know Who Is in Charge
HighBased on the DFPS investigation it was determined that the none of the staff understood who was in charge of the center while the director was out of the building.
746.1013(c)Corrected 2024-01-19AP Responsibilities of Employees and Caregivers -Ensure No Child Abused, Neglected, or Exploited
HighBased on the information gained during the investigation, the caregiver's actions do rise to the level of abuse as defined by the Texas Family Code since the child was observed with marks and bruises due to inappropriate restraint.
746.1201(4)Corrected 2024-01-19Child/Caregiver Ratio - 18 Months Difference in Age
HighDuring the course of the DFPS investigation, it was determined that the infant caregiver was in charge of infants and afterschool children with one of the youngest school age children being at least 6 years old with the infants at least 17 months of age.
746.1605(1)Corrected 2024-01-19 - routine#862230491
